Output 878b62b657b987a1ee1496e90e242587ec523fa4bb65856bd02e87676939819a:0

value
59199
script pubkey
OP_0 OP_PUSHBYTES_32 5b5c9bf254c2752bcfaa0139bccd1d23c3a9bca6c3d46b30004905e1e6610ba8
address
bc1qtdwfhuj5cf6jhna2qyumengay0p6n09xc02xkvqqfyz7renppw5qhmha6z
transaction
878b62b657b987a1ee1496e90e242587ec523fa4bb65856bd02e87676939819a
confirmations
165936
spent
true